The DCI on Tuesday launched a manhunt for two gangsters who
were seen shooting a bystander in Eastleigh.
In the CCTV footage shared on social media, there seems to
be commotion outside a shop in Eastleigh’s 14th street before
onlookers scamper for safety.
It is at this point that a motorbike carrying two men speeds
in their direction and in the ensuing melee, a man falls to the ground.
The video was shared by a netizen who asked police to
investigate the matter and the DCI assured that they had already started
tracking the gangsters.
“Robbers shot someone in a botched robbery in Eastleigh 14th
street. These guys must be brought to book. @DCI_Kenya.”
The DCI also revealed that the man who was shot by the thugs
is in stable condition.
This comes just two weeks after two thugs were captured on
CCTV robbing a wines and spirits shop in Umoja Estate.
In the video, the two initially posed as customers before
one brandished a pistol and ordered the occupants to lie down.
They ransacked the drawers before leaving but no one was
injured during the incident.
Last month the DCI arrested four suspects in connection with
a robbery incident in Kilimani where a man lost his phone and laptop as he
headed to work.
The video had been widely shared on social media and the suspects were later smoked out of their hideouts in Kawangware, Gatina and Pangani.
